El Enemigo Wines Semillon 2019
Adrianna, the youngest daughter of Nicolás Catena Zapata, has lived and breathed wine since childhood. Alejandro Vigil has been head winemaker of Bodega Catena Zapata since 2002, receiving the first 100-point rating awarded to a South American wine by Robert Parker. Two romantic winemakers create El Enemigo (the enemy), a name inspired by Dante's Divine Comedy. "At the end of the journey we remember only one battle. The one we fought against ourselves, the one that defines us.".
In the El Enemigo Semillon, fermentation takes place in 500lt French barrels for 17 months (10% new) with indigenous yeasts. The wine remains under a layer of flor for 17 months and the lees are not stirred.
In the glass we have a pale golden color. On the nose we find complex aromas of citrus fruits, stone fruits, with a botanical character following and notes of yeast and nuts completing its character. On the palate it is full-bodied, with high acidity and a long aftertaste.
